Create exports
Create an export for a component so that its business service can be used by other modules.
You create an export for a component by using the assembly editor. Follow any of these steps to create an export:
- Select the export from the palette and drop it into the assembly diagram.
- Select the component in the assembly diagram. Right-click to select Export and the type of binding. For information about bindings, see the related tasks.
- Drag an interface or import into the assembly diagram. When prompted, select the Export with No Binding or Export with Web Service Binding, depending on what you require. Later, you can use the right-click actions to generate, remove, or replace the binding. To use interfaces from a library, you will have to open the module with the dependency editor and add a dependency on the library. You will be prompted if the dependency has to be set.
- Drag a web service port from the Business Integration view into the assembly diagram. An export is created with that port. If you use this method, you need to provide an address for the export in proper form.
- To create an export that uses an adapter, from the Inbound Adapters folder on the assembly editor palette, select an adapter and drag it onto the canvas. Complete the fields in the wizard to generate the export.
